Webniggardliness: 1 n extreme stinginess Synonyms: closeness , meanness , minginess , niggardness , parsimoniousness , parsimony , tightfistedness , tightness Types: littleness … WebOct 11, 2014 · Stinginess is not the same as frugality. While frugality is an intelligent and efficient use of time, energy and resources, stinginess is a form of fear- a fear of not having enough. It motivates a person not to …

Stingy literally means “not generous, unwilling to spend; miser” In Islamic sources, Quran and hadith, it is generally expressed with the Arabic words “shuhh” and “bukhl”. Stinginess has levels. The last level is man’s depriving himself from what he needs and not spending anything even for his own need.
